Innovation seen as small steps

We all tend to talk about innovation.  It is almost obligatory to have this word in your dictionary today.  People who don't talk on changes and growth are often claimed to be reactive,  passive,  etc.  And still, after so many discussions on the topic of innovation, still many companies and leaders can't explain what they…